Razor语法

Razor是一种标记语法,用于将基于服务器的代码签入网页中。Razor语法有Razor标记、c#和html组成。包含razor的文件通常具有.cshtml文件扩展名。

呈现HTML

默认razor语言为html。从razor标记呈现html与从html文件呈现并没有什么不同。服务器会按原样呈现.cshtml razor文件中html标记。

---恢复内容结束---

Razor是一种标记语法,用于将基于服务器的代码签入网页中。Razor语法有Razor标记、c#和html组成。包含razor的文件通常具有.cshtml文件扩展名。

呈现HTML

默认razor语言为html。从razor标记呈现html与从html文件呈现并没有什么不同。服务器会按原样呈现.cshtml razor文件中html标记。

Razor是一种标记语法,用于将基于服务器的代码签入网页中。Razor语法有Razor标记、c#和html组成。包含razor的文件通常具有.cshtml文件扩展名。

呈现HTML

默认razor语言为html。从razor标记呈现html与从html文件呈现并没有什么不同。服务器会按原样呈现.cshtml razor文件中html标记。

隐式Razor:

1):以@开头,后跟c#代码:<p>@DateTime.Now</p>

2):不能包含空格

3):不能包含c#泛型

显示Razor:

由@和平衡圆括号组成,这样可以解决隐式Razor空格和不能包含c#泛型的问题。

  

posted @ 2018-06-11 09:53  v-haoz  阅读(123)  评论(0编辑  收藏  举报